View uOmnispace.MR →When choosing between Arterys Cardio DL and uOmnispace.MR, physicians should consider their primary focus and existing infrastructure. Arterys Cardio DL excels in cardiac MRI analysis, specifically with its automated, editable ventricle segmentations and 4D Flow post-processing. Its cloud-based deployment offers accessibility and rapid analysis, significantly reducing interpretation time. This tool is ideal for cardiologists and radiologists heavily focused on cardiac imaging who prioritize speed and advanced blood flow visualization.
In contrast, uOmnispace.MR provides a broader suite of AI-powered MR image analysis tools, extending beyond cardiology to include brain and breast imaging. While it also offers AI-driven cardiac ventricular segmentation and cardiac function analysis, its key practical difference lies in its versatility across multiple specialties and its flexible deployment options, including standalone software or integration with other applications. Physicians in multi-specialty practices or those requiring a comprehensive MR analysis platform for diverse clinical applications, such as neurology or oncology, would find uOmnispace.MR more suitable.
Ultimately, a physician whose practice is predominantly cardiac MRI-centric and values a streamlined, cloud-based workflow for specialized cardiac analysis would lean towards Arterys Cardio DL. Conversely, a physician seeking a more expansive, multi-specialty MR image analysis solution with flexible deployment to support a wider range of diagnostic needs would likely prefer uOmnispace.MR.

Feature-by-Feature
Detail beyond the Quick Comparison summary. For pricing, deployment, BAA, FDA, and HIPAA see the Overview tab.
| Feature | Arterys Cardio DL | uOmnispace.MR |
|---|---|---|
| Product Name | Arterys Cardio DL | uOmnispace.MR |
| Company | ARTERYS | Shanghai United Imaging Healthcare Co., Ltd. |
| Primary Clinical Categories | Cardiology AI, Radiology & Imaging AI | Cardiology AI, Neurology AI, Oncology AI |
| Cardiac Ventricle Segmentation | Automated, editable ventricle segmentations for cardiac MRI analysis | AI-driven cardiac ventricular segmentation |
| Other Key Features / Applications | Deep learning algorithms for image analysis, Vendor-agnostic compatibility, Rapid analysis (seconds vs. 30-60 minutes), 4D Flow post-processing, Quantitative Delayed Enhancement analysis | MR image viewing, processing, and analysis, Stitching for full-format MR images, Dynamic studies analysis, MR Spectroscopy (SVS and CSI), Perfusion analysis (e.g., Brain Perfusion), Vessel analysis for MR vascular images, Cardiac function analysis |
